I use the "sweet spot" setting in fldigi Misc configuration to center the modes at 1500 Hz of the Flex bandpass. Then I tune with Flex. In DIGL & DIGU modes, the 10Hz tuning steps work well for me. I also set fldigi to display the Flex frequency so I can get close a spotted station pretty quickly.1

Your digital mode program should properly calculate the ASFK offset if you have CAT enabled so the program and the radio are frequency synchronized. As Dave said, Fldigi shows you this. Others do too. If you want to QSO with someone or send spots, you should tell them your actual transmitted frequency which will not be the radio's frequency readout since there will be an audio frequency offset of some value depending on where you have the decoder/encoder placed on the digital mode waterfall and if you are operating upper sideband (positive offset from the radio's frequency readout) or lower sideband (negative offset).0
